"Great Hotel! Excellent Location!"

We stayed here for 6 nights in Early November for our anniversary. We have nothing but NICE things to say about King George. The room and service was excellent. They had a daily turn down service where they left us some really great chocolates. (We looked forward to the them!) The rooms were always clean. Our bathroom was also very luxurious - it had a seperate tub and standing shower.

The location couldnt be better - literally steps away from the Syntagma Metro station. The best and cheapest way to get to this hotel from the Airport is the Metro. The line that runs from the Airport goes straight to the Syntagma station. We did not try the restaurants in the hotel - so cant comment on them. We were able to walk to Ermou Street and the Plaka area very easily. The Acropolis was also a walkable distance (longer walk). Some of the other places we could walk to were: the National Gardens, Temple of Olympian Zeus, Kolonaki Square.

"improved but ready for prime time"

The king George has undergone a major renovation and is a grande hotel in a prime location. The service is great.The room layouts are not functional ie the high speed internet connects thru the TV which is on the opposite side of the room from the desk,the TV is next to the bed and not across so you cannot watch while in bed, small uncomfprtable chairs, the health club does not open until 11 am,the breakfast buffet is skimpy.There is no outdoor pool.The Athens Plaza next door offers same great location with more modern and convenient amenaties.

Plaka Area
 
As soon as you start walking around Plaka's stone-paved, narrow streets, you will have the feeling that you are travelling back in time. This is Athens' oldest and, thanks to the restoration efforts which went into its buildings in recent years, most picturesque neighbourhood. You will be delighted by the beauty of the neo-classical colours of its houses, their architecture, their lovingly tended little gardens, the elegance, and the total atmosphere of the area.
